NRG Radio unveiled the first-ever Halftime Show set to take place at the ASFAs Honorary Gala on 19th December 2025 at the Kampala Serena Hotel where top musicians will be performing.
This will bring in a huge shift in the ASFAs experience, making it the first fashion awards event in Africa to introduce a dedicated mid-show entertainment performance.
NRG Radio’s Head of Brand, Barbra Lynda, told journalists that this is part of redefining how fashion, music and youth culture merge at premium events.
“NRG is proud to be part of this new chapter of the ASFAs. Fashion, music and youth culture have always moved together, and the halftime show gives us a chance to bring that connection to life in a way Africa hasn’t seen before, This is our moment to introduce a new wave to the Honorary Gala and showcase one African musician at a level that’s never been done before. Vinka is headlining the first show because her journey, style and cultural impact mirror exactly what this moment needs,” she said.

Although currently out of the country, Vinka sent in a recorded message saying;
“I’m bringing the fire to the ASFAs Honorary Gala this December 19th at the Serena Hotel. I’m headlining the NRG Halftime Show and trust me… this one is going to shake the room, If you thought you’d seen fashion and music come together before… you haven’t seen anything yet.” she declared.
Beyond the Halftime Show reveal, the ASFAs confirmed a star-packed performance lineup featuring Elijah Kitaka, Kevin Kade from Rwanda, Sweden’s Tyra Chantey, Rickman, Karole Kasita, Warafiki, Dance by Valentino, DJ Vee and DJ Harold.
Ciroc, one of the major partners, reaffirmed its long-standing association with the ASFAs through Reserve Brand Ambassador Melanie Abwooli, who also reappointed Brian Ahumuza as Ciroc Ambassador. She emphasized the perfect match between luxury fashion and the brand’s bold, premium identity.

The gala will also be streamed globally via Play It Loud, which officially launches on 10th December 2025. According to Shafik Nekambuza, the platform ensures that viewers worldwide can be part of the ASFAs even if they miss out on the restricted ticket allocation.
Set for 19th December 2025 at the Kampala Serena Hotel, this year’s Honorary Gala promises an exclusive, high-luxury fashion showcase featuring top regional and international designers, electrifying music performances and the debut of the NRG ASFA Halftime Show.
